Logistic Growth
A model of population growth where the rate decreases as the population reaches its carrying capacity, eventually stabilizing.
Exponential Growth
A growth pattern in which the number of entities increases at a rate proportional to the current number, resulting in a rapid increase over time.

Logistic growth involves a rapid exponential population growth followed by a slowing down of the population growth rate as the carrying capacity of the environment is approached, but not necessarily a drastic decrease in population growth.
